Overview of SimWiz and Its Core Features

SimWiz is a sophisticated simulation software designed to cater to various industries. It provides users with a platform to create, analyze, and visualize complex scenarios. This capability is crucial for professionals who rely on accurate simulations to make informed decisions. SimWiz enhances productivity and efficiency. It is a game changer.

The software integrates advanced algorithms and user-friendly interfaces. This combination allows users to navigate through simulations with ease. Many professionals appreciate its intuitive design. It simplifies complex processes. Users can focus on analysis rather than technical difficulties.

SimWiz supports a wide range of applications, from education to healthcare. Each industry benefits from tailored features that address specific needs. For instance, in education, it fosters interactive learning experiehces. Engaging students is essential for effective teaching. In healthcare, it aids in training medical personnel through realistic scenarios. Realism is key in medical training.

Moreover, SimWiz offers robust data analysis tools. These tools enable users to interpret simulation results effectively. Understanding data is vital for strategic planning. Professionals can derive actionable insights from their simulations. This capability enhances decision-making processes across various sectors. Data-driven decisions lead to better outcomes.

    Utilizing SimWiz in the Manufacturing Industry

    Streamlining Processes and Improving Efficiency

    Utilizing SimWiz in the manufacturing industry significantly enhances operational efficiency. The software allows for the simulation of production processes, enabling manufacturers to identify bottlenecks. By analyzing these simulations, companies can implement targeted improvements. This approach leads to reduced waste and optimized resource allocation. Efficiency is crucial for profitability.

    For example, SimWiz can model various production scenarios. It helps in assessing the impact of changes in workflow. Manufacturers can evaluate different strategies before implementation. This proactive approach minimizes risks associated with process changes. Understanding potential outcomes is essential for informed decision-making.

    Moreover, SimWiz facilitates real-time data analysis. It provides insights into production metrics, allowing for timely adjustments. Quick responses to data trends can prevent costly delays. Staying ahead of issues is vital in a competitive market.

    Additionally, the software supports training for employees. Workers can practice their skills in a simulated environment. This hands-on experience enhances their understanding of processes. Skilled employees contribute to overall efficiency. Investing in training pays off in the long run.

    In summary, the integration of SimWiz in manufacturing streamlines processes and boosts productivity. It empowers companies to work data-driven decisions. This leads to improved operational outcomes and increased profitability.

    SimWiz in the Automotive Sector: Innovations and Benefits

    Driving Design and Testing with Advanced Simulations

    SimWiz plays a crucial role in the automotive sector by driving design and testing through advanced simulations . This software enables engineers to create detailed models of vehicles, allowing for comprehensive analysis before physical prototypes are built. By simulating various conditions, manufacturers can identify potential design flaws early in the process. Early detection saves time and resources.

    Furthermore, SimWiz facilitates the testing of vehicle performance under different scenarios. Engineers can assess how vehicles respond to various driving conditions, such as weather changes or road surfaces. This capability enhances safety and reliability. Understanding performance metrics is essential for consumer trust.

    In addition, the software supports collaboration among design teams. Multiple stakeholders can work on simulations simultaneously, streamlining the development process. This collaborative approach fosters innovation and accelerates time-to-market. Teamwork is vital in automotive design.

    Moreover, SimWiz provides valuable data analytics tools. These tools allow manufacturers to analyze simulation results effectively. Data-driven insights lead to informed decision-making. Making decisions based on solid data is crucial for success.

    Overall, the integration of SimWiz in the automotive industry enhances design efficiency and product quality. It empowers manufacturers to innovate while minimizing risks. This approach ultimately leads to better vehicles and improved customer satisfaction.
